Subject: DR drill — SQL lint rules now enforced

Team,

During Thursday's disaster-recovery drill for Marlowett, the restore scripts failed our new SQL linting rules (uppercase keywords, no SELECT *, explicit schemas). Please fix flagged files before the next drill so restores run cleanly. To open the drill's restore console on the standby host, enter the recovery passphrase below.

recovery phrase for fajep-yaweg: gilath-sorox-wenius-rusdor-keliel-zorius

**Leadership Review Briefing — Project Kestrel**

Quick heads-up for the finance team ahead of Thursday's review. We've been circling Bramblewick Systems for about six weeks, and their founders are finally warm to a deal. Their tooling would slot neatly under our Fieldline platform, and the customer overlap is smaller than we feared. Valuation talk is still loose — somewhere between ambitious and absurd. Marta will walk through the diligence gaps on the call. The note below covers where we'd like to land.

confidential, bagap-kahog: Only 9 of the 80 pilot accounts renewed Oliath, so a churn review is set for April 15.

### Load testing checkout

Quick heads-up for plugin authors: when we hammer the Tindergrove checkout flow in the Brambleton load rig, your hooks run inside the same latency budget as core steps. If your plugin blows past the per-hook deadline, the rig marks the whole run degraded. Plan around the knobs we actually enforce, which are listed in the table below.

tuning constants:
QUOTAS = {
    "druwyn": 5,
    "holix": 5,
    "zorath": 5,
    "holwyn": 10,
}

## Building Access — Level 4 Opening

Level 4 of Merrowgate House opens Thursday. Facilities desk staff should note: the badge readers on Level 4 are live but not yet synced with the main access database, so standard staff badges will fail until the weekend update. Direct complaints to the access team, not engineering. For escorted access in the meantime, staff should use the temporary code below.

badge for badup-kahif: bdg-LHI-9